Alcohol testing determines the presence and concentration of ethanol in the body. It's critical for preventing accidents and ensuring compliance with various regulations in Cleghorn, Iowa. Various testing methods, including breath, urine, blood, and saliva tests, are deployed based on situational needs.
Alcohol Testing is used in many settings
Common Methods of Alcohol Testing
Blood tests - Used to measure precise blood alcohol content.
Breathalyzers - Convenient for roadside law enforcement checks.
Urine tests - Indicative of longer-term use.
Saliva tests - Useful for quick screening in various settings.
Hair follicle drug testing in Cleghorn, Iowa is a reliable method for detecting long-term drug use. By examining hair samples, this test identifies drug molecules that become integrated into the hair shaft, providing exposure information for up to 90 days. It is widely used for its robust detection capabilities across a range of substances.
